如何在SQL数据库中执行复杂的数据操作和计算?

SQL数据库是一种广泛应用的关系型数据库,它能够支持各种复杂的数据操作和计算。在处理大量数据和复杂计算问题时,SQL数据库可以通过使用存储过程、触发器、视图、索引等功能,实现高效、可靠、灵活的数据操作和计算。本文将介绍SQL数据库中实现复杂数据操作和计算的方法,包括存储过程、触发器、视图、索引等,以及它们在企业应用中的重要性和实际应用案例。

如何在SQL数据库中执行复杂的数据操作和计算?

SQL数据库是一种广泛应用的关系型数据库,它提供了一系列丰富的功能和工具,可以支持各种复杂的数据操作和计算。

存储过程

存储过程是一种预编译的SQL语句集合,它可以保存在数据库中并由应用程序调用。存储过程可以接受参数,并根据参数返回结果。存储过程可以在服务器端执行,从而减少了客户端与服务器之间的通信量,提高了数据操作的效率。

触发器

触发器是一种在数据库发生特定事件时自动执行的SQL语句集合。触发器可以响应INSERT、UPDATE、DELETE等事件,并在事件发生时执行相应的SQL语句。通过使用触发器,可以实现数据的自动更新、记录的自动归档等功能。

视图

视图是一种虚拟的表,它是由一个或多个基本表按照某种规则组合而成的。视图可以对基本表进行聚合、过滤、排序等操作,并将结果作为一个新的表呈现给用户。通过使用视图,可以简化复杂查询的编写,并提高查询效率。

索引

索引是一种特殊的数据结构,它可以加速基于列的数据检索。通过在列上创建索引,可以减少数据检索的时间和资源消耗。索引可以根据不同的算法进行优化,以适应不同的数据和查询需求。

重要性和实际应用案例

在企业应用中,SQL数据库能够支持各种复杂的数据操作和计算,从而提高了数据管理和应用的效率和质量。例如,在金融行业中,SQL数据库可以用于高效地处理大量的交易数据和计算风险指标,保障企业的稳健运营。在电商行业中,SQL数据库可以用于效率地处理大量的订单数据和计算销售指标,提高企业的收益和竞争力。

如何在SQL数据库中执行复杂的数据操作和计算?

综上所述,SQL数据库通过使用存储过程、触发器、视图、索引等功能,可以实现高效、可靠、灵活的数据操作和计算。在企业应用中,SQL数据库的重要性和实际应用价值日益凸显,成为企业数据管理和应用的重要基础设施之一。

文章链接: https://www.mfisp.com/27428.html

文章标题:如何在SQL数据库中执行复杂的数据操作和计算?

文章版权:梦飞科技所发布的内容,部分为原创文章,转载请注明来源,网络转载文章如有侵权请联系我们!

声明:本站所有文章,如无特殊说明或标注,均为本站原创发布。任何个人或组织,在未征得本站同意时,禁止复制、盗用、采集、发布本站内容到任何网站、书籍等各类媒体平台。如若本站内容侵犯了原著者的合法权益,可联系我们进行处理。

给TA打赏
共{{data.count}}人
人已打赏
服务器vps推荐

天翼云服务器如何保证网络的稳定性和安全性?

2024-2-20 10:42:35

服务器vps推荐

SD-WAN如何保障网络的高可用性和冗余性?

2024-2-20 10:46:09

0 条回复 A文章作者 M管理员
    暂无讨论,说说你的看法吧
个人中心
购物车
优惠劵
今日签到
有新私信 私信列表
搜索

梦飞科技 - 最新云主机促销服务器租用优惠